Keystone Recalls Husky Fifth Wheel Trailer Hitches Due to Fastener Loosening

Keystone is recalling specific Husky fifth wheel trailer hitches because fasteners may loosen, potentially causing the jaws to open unexpectedly and increasing crash risk.

Plain-English summary

Keystone Automotive Operations, Inc. is recalling certain Husky Towing Products fifth wheel trailer hitches, specifically part numbers 31569/14-1706 and 31570/14-1707. The recall affects approximately 25,000 units.

The defect involves fasteners in the fifth wheel trailer hitch that may loosen. This can potentially cause the jaws to unexpectedly open or prevent the jaws from being unlocked. If the jaws open unexpectedly, the fifth wheel trailer will not be secured to the tow vehicle, which increases the risk of a crash.

The recall began on May 4, 2018. Keystone will notify owners, and dealers will replace the affected hardware using thread locker free of charge. Owners may contact Keystone customer service at 1-800-432-8063 or the NHTSA Vehicle Safety Hotline at 1-888-327-4236.
